在Python中,将时间戳(timestamp)转换为字符串(str)是一个常见的操作。以下是一个详细的步骤指南,并附上了相应的代码示例: 导入Python的datetime模块: python from datetime import datetime 获取时间戳: 时间戳通常指的是自1970年1月1日(Unix纪元或Epoch时间)以来的秒数。你可以使用time.time()函数来获取当前...
下面的代码示例展示了如何创建一个Timestamp对象并将其转换为字符串: importpandasaspd# 创建一个Timestamp对象timestamp=pd.Timestamp('2023-10-10 12:30:45')# 转换为字符串,使用strftime自定义时间格式timestamp_str=timestamp.strftime('%Y-%m-%d %H:%M:%S')print("Timestamp对象:",timestamp)print("转换...
步骤2: 创建一个Timestamp 为了演示,我们可以选择一个具体的Timestamp,例如1633072800(表示2021年10月1日 00:00:00 UTC)。 timestamp=1633072800# 创建一个时间戳 1. 步骤3: 将Timestamp转换为datetime对象 使用datetime.fromtimestamp()方法,我们可以将Timestamp转换为datetime对象,方便后续处理。 dt_object=datetim...
1、时间戳转换格式化时间 importtimedeftimestamp_to_str(timestamp=None,format='%Y-%m-%d %H:%M:%S'):'''这个是把时间戳转换成格式化好的实际,如果不传时间戳,那么就返回当前的时间'''iftimestamp:returntime.strftime(format,time.localtime(timestamp))else:returntime.strftime(format,time.localtime())pr...
unix_timestamp = convert_to_unix_timestamp(timestamp_str) print(f"Unix时间戳: {unix_timestamp}") ``` 在这段代码中,`datetime.strptime()`函数将字符串时间戳解析为`datetime`对象,然后通过`time.mktime()`函数将其转换为Unix时间戳(以秒为单位的整数)。
转载地址:http://liyangliang.me/posts/2012/10/python-timestamp-to-timestr/ 在写Python的时候经常会遇到时间格式的问题,每次都是上 google 搜索然后找别人的博客或网站来参考。现在自己简单总结一下,方便以后查询。 首先就是最近用到的时间戳(timestamp)和时间字符串之间的转换。所谓时间戳,就是从 1970 年 1...
如果它说“strptime() argument 1 must be str, not Timestamp”,很可能你已经有了pandas.Timestamp对象,也就是说,它不是一个字符串,而是一个解析的日期时间,只是它在 Pandas 中’ 格式,而不是 Python 的。所以要转换,使用这个: date_time_obj = date.to_pydatetime() ...
python3 进行字符串、日期、时间、时间戳相关转换 文章被收录于专栏:热爱IT热爱IT 1、字符串转换成时间戳 2、 日期转换成时间戳
本笔记仅是为了方便个人查阅转换方法,内容来源已贴在下方。作者的关系图我重做了一下,一并贴入本笔记。 python time, datetime, string, timestamp相互转换
timestamp=time.time()datetime_str=timestamp_to_str(timestamp)print(datetime_str) 1. 2. 3. 4. 5. 6. 7. 8. 9. 上述代码定义了一个timestamp_to_str()函数,接受一个时间戳作为参数,并返回格式化后的日期时间字符串。然后我们获取当前的时间戳,并将其传递给timestamp_to_str()函数进行转换和输出。